Quick insights from ISI Powered by AI

This insight was generated by AI, based on latest ISI report.

Foundational Skills: Teaching enables good progress with effective behaviour management and suitable resources.
Success of the Curriculum: Curriculum is documented, supported by plans and schemes covering required material breadth.
Areas Needing Improvement: Consider strengthening further pupils' understanding of diversity in modern Britain.
Performance in Maths & Reading: Pupils' attainment is excellent, demonstrating rapid progress and high competence in ICT.
Support for Falling Behind: Most able and SEND pupils attain highly and make strong progress over time.
Behaviour and Attitudes: Pupils display passionate and focused attitudes towards learning.
Support for SEND Pupils: 52 pupils identified with SEND, 33 receive additional specialist help. No pupil has EHC plan.
Managing Bullying and Pupil Safety: Arrangements safeguard and promote welfare with strategic risk assessment approach.
Promotion of Welfare and Safety: School promotes welfare; standards for safety and behaviour are met.
Parent Feedback: Most parents agree teaching enables pupil progress and active promotion of core values.
Parental Involvement: Information is available to parents including complaints procedures and safeguarding policy.
Extracurricular Activities: Emphasis on sports and expressive arts, many opportunities for pupil participation.
Outdoor Facilities: New cricket facilities and tennis courts recently installed.
Teacher Engagement: Teachers support pupil learning and achievement with effective engagement.
Impact on Student Progress: Teaching supports rapid progress, meeting full potential.
Assessment of Teaching Quality: Quality is assessed through robust curriculum documentation and student performance tracking.

About Us

Thorngrove School is a Middle Deemed Primary, Co-Ed school located in Hampshire, South East.

It has 226 students from age 2-13 yr.

Tuition fee £265 to £7,255 for the highest grade offered.

From the Thorngrove School
I feel extremely lucky and blessed to serve as Headmaster of Thorngrove School. I first came to this school more than fifteen years ago as the deputy head, and I quickly saw that it was and still is a truly unique place. Since I took over as Headmaster in 2009, I've enjoyed managing the school. Every kid can enjoy a wide range of subjects thanks to our extensive curriculum and be motivated by knowledgeable, enthusiastic teachers. Our grounds are absolutely beautiful, with over 25 acres giving the kids the room to be active, creative, and thoughtful. Last but not least, our pastoral care is unmatched, with devoted and committed professionals establishing a loving environment that offers every child a joyful and nurturing setting. In a world that is always changing, children encounter numerous obstacles. However, I think that Thorngrove can give your child the best possible start in life, both academically and emotionally.
